Transaction 5bdebaa45e69422e330ae7244ef94cc743c0b9481878c91a773db76561c1d3f8
1 Input
1 Output
-
5bdebaa45e69422e330ae7244ef94cc743c0b9481878c91a773db76561c1d3f8:0
- value
- 3376292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aea63fe6fa837adc09fbc036827b5ea4c774ac87 OP_EQUAL
- address
- 3HcUf9YtN6maAdd1zAbUu6hdynTBEyVSKw